In today’s Buffalo News, it is revealed that former Mayor Tony Masiello has $782,049 of leftover campaign funds at his disposal. So far, he has used the money to support the local Democratic Party, the candidacy of Mark Poloncarz for Erie County Comptroller as well as several other personal expenses and causes. As described in last week’s Buffalo News, Masiello is now a lobbyist for Government Action Professionals and will most certainly leverage his former position and large bank account to win new clients and lobby for favorable legislation.
